SLU empowers future scientists through SONAHBS outreach program guided by CEOPO

Saint Louis University (SLU), through the SLU Community Extension and Outreach Programs Office (CEOPO) and Biology Department of the School of Nursing, Allied Health, and Biological Sciences (SONAHBS), conducted an outreach program titled “Empowering Future Scientists: Science Laboratory and Field Skills for Science High School Students and Teachers” at San Isidro School of Abatan, Inc., in Buguias, Benguet, on 17 January 2025. The program aimed to enhance the scientific knowledge and practical skills of both students and teachers through hands-on activities such as microscopy and frog dissection.

SLU empowers Banangan Women of Sablan, Benguet during the  7th CICM Friendship Meet

The Banangan Women from Banangan, Sablan, Benguet, made significant strides in their community through entrepreneurship and craftsmanship,  showcasing their culinary talents during the 7th CICM Friendship Meet held from 19-23 February 2024, in Saint Louis University. This event did not only highlight their skills but also emphasized the importance of local women in fostering community engagement and economic development through innovative food products and traditional recipes.
